Doctrinal New Testament Commentary Volume II Acts - Philippians 1975 HC. ... 30 days: Money Back: WebPhilippians 1:19–30 speak of Paul's hope of being released from house arrest (Philippians 1:19). In either case, life or death, Paul was content, though he expected to continue serving at that time. He clearly planned to visit the believers in Philippi again (Philippians 1:26).
